All you need to do is download the training document, open it and start learning php for free. When compiling, use with pdo mysqldir to install the pdo mysql extension, where the optional dir is the mysql base library. Note that pdo is just an abstract layer that allows you to use a common library to access any databases. Learning php ebook pdf download this ebook for free chapters. Abstract this manual describes the php extensions and interfaces that can be used with mysql. The recommended configure line for building php with pdo support. It is not developed or intended for use in any inherently dangerous. If pdo is built as a shared modules, all pdo drivers must also be built as shared modules.
Rasmus lerdorf unleashed the first version of php way back in 1994. Getting started with php, variables, variable scope, superglobal variables php, outputting the value of a variable, constants, magic constants, comments, types, operators, references, arrays, array iteration, executing upon an array, manipulating an array, datetime class and loops. Click scripting and then install pluginmodule from the menu to open a file browser. This manual describes the php extensions and interfaces that can be used with mysql. Run the following command to download, build, and install the latest. After restarting mysql workbench, load the mysql connection to use to generate the php code. Pdf presentation performed internally in the company ixcsoft. Pdocrud is advance pdo database management system that creates fields on the basis of the field type and field name as defined in the database table from the database tables directly by writing 23 lines of codes only. Php mysql javascript and html5 all in one for dummies. Imagine the following scenario, lets say you are building a shopping cart for an ecommerce website and you decided to keep the orders in two database tables. Professional lamp linux apache mysql and php5 web development. Your contribution will go a long way in helping us serve.
This course is adapted to your level as well as all php pdf courses to better enrich your knowledge. The pdo mysql driver sits in the layer below pdo itself, and provides mysqlspecific functionality. User manual download the user manual to read more about dopdf. Basically the answer from jani hartikainen is right. Pdoprepare prepares a statement for execution and returns a statement object. Looking at the server logs shows two get request to the download. For details about choosing a library, see choosing a mysql library.
Take advantage of this course called object oriented programming in php5 to improve your web development skills and better understand php. Take advantage of this course called object oriented programming in php5 to improve your web development skills and better understand php this course is adapted to your level as well as all php pdf courses to better enrich your knowledge all you need to do is download the training document, open it and start learning php for free this tutorial has been prepared for the. How to upload, insert, update and delete file using php pdo. Php basic pdo connection and retrieval php tutorial. Hypertext preprocessor is a widelyused open source generalpurpose scripting language that is especially suited for web development and can be embedded into html. Otherwise, you will lose the added injection prevention benefits, that are. Once you click on the download button, you will be prompted to select the files you need.
Php is a serverside, htmlembedded scripting language that may be used to create dynamic web pages. In case of a failure, the function either returns false or throws an exception depending upon how the pdo connection was configured. When the user clicks on that link, the script below is what runs in addition to the other code above for download. If you are programming with php, youll have to use either mysqli i means improved or pdo extension. A crash course in pdo comparity training resources. Easy to use for debugging php scripts, publishing projects to remote servers through ftp, webdav, cvs. Pdos documentation hierarchy, definitions, and hse management system.
With that in mind, we will use the pdo extension in. The only proper pdo tutorial treating php delusions. Although pdo offers a function for returning the number of rows found by the query, pdostatementrowcount. Php pdo tutorial introduces you to one of the most important php extensions called php data objects or pdo, which was available since php version 5. In the context of sqlite, it needs sqlite3 extension to.
It is recommended that you build pdo as a shared extension, as this will allow you to take advantage of updates that are made available via pecl. By writing just 23 lines of code only, you can perform insertupdatedelete and select operation. We already have a simple file uploading tutorial in this blog and now this tutorial demonstrates how you can upload a files using php and store uploaded file into the mysql database. Php mysql pdo manual printable 2019download this great ebook and read the php mysql pdo manual printable 2019 ebook.
It is an alternative for the mssql drivers that were deprecated as of php 5. With that in mind, we will use the pdo extension in this simple php crud tutorial. For help with using mysql, please visit the mysql forums, where you can discuss your issues with other mysql users. Php mysql pdo manual printable 2019 free reading at brazilfilmfestival. User manual pdf enduser license agreement dopdf has an enduser license agreement eula that you have to. The pear documentation has detailed install instructions for every operating system. As a result, half of pdo s features remain in obscurity and are almost never used by php developers, who, as a result, are constantly trying to reinvent the wheel which already exists in pdo. Practical example using transactions with pdo in the following section is demonstrated a practical real world example where the use of transactions ensures the consistency of database. Pdolastinsertid returns the id of the last inserted row or sequence value. To proceed with the installation, you need to download some files first.
Pdoquery executes an sql statement, returning a result set as a pdostatement object. Otherwise, you will lose the added injection prevention benefits, that are usually granted by using prepared statements. Not its own api, but instead its a mysql driver for the php database abstraction layer pdo php data objects. Since pdo was designed to be compatible with older mysql server versions which did not have support for prepared statements, you have to explicitly disable the emulation. Phped php ide integrated development environment for developing web sites using php, html, perl, jscript and css that combines a comfortable editor, debugger, profiler with the mysql, postrgesql database support based on easy wizards and tutorials.
How to file upload and view with php and mysql coding cage. Pdocrud documentation advance php crud application. Php is a server side scripting language that is embedded in html. Pdo hse management system manual cp122 introduction page 3 table one. If your code uses this combination, you will encounter segmentation faults during the cleanup of the php process. You just to need to create object and call for render function for that table and everything will be generated automatically. Scroll down the system variables list and click on path followed by the edit button. The sqlsrv driver is a microsoft supported php extension that allows you to access microsoft sql server and sql azure databases. The pdo mysql driver sits in the layer below pdo itself, and provides. It is database agnostic, and so the following connection example code should work for any of its supported databases simply by changing the dsn. Pdo php data objects provides a vendorneutral method of accessing a.
Php and mysql crud tutorial for beginners step by step guide. Ms sql server pdo odbc and db2 pdo postgresql pdo the following drivers currently implement the pdo interface. The application offers you many ways to work with your data, you can use it as plain php library or with your favorite framework and cms. Learn object oriented programming oop in php learn object oriented programming oop in php objectoriented programming oop is a type of programming added to php5 that makes building complex, modular and reusable web applications that much easier. Find, read and cite all the research you need on researchgate. Unlike those, this tutorial is written by someone who has used pdo for many years, dug through it, and answered thousands questions on stack overflow the. Php and mysql crud tutorial for beginners step by step. With php its easy to upload any files that you want to the server, you can upload mp3, image, videos, pdf etc. An easytoread, quick reference for php best practices, accepted.
For help with using mysql, please visit the mysql forums, where you can discuss your issues with other mysql. In addition, pdo does not require you to include script files in your application like other libraries, which helps distribute and install the application easier and faster. Php started out as a small open source project that evolved as more and more people found out how useful it was. Php document object plus is library with functionality of pdo, entirely written in php, so that developer can easily extend its classes with specific functionality. From the menu, click tools, utilities, and then mysql pdo connect to server, which is the caption defined within the plugin code. The underground php and oracle manual christopher jones and alison holloway php. If you install it with package managers, you just have to use the command line given by jany hartikainen.
1389 101 1147 403 144 606 891 85 178 773 939 672 535 1504 996 1014 1057 920 984 215 1018 1089 35 247 1344 40 33 1145 535 1304